Hey i was wondering how does molten salt affect ur pipes? and what methods do you use for maintenance if this is an issue? i am thinkin about how corrosion might be a huge factor here as i recall liquids with salt being really bad for metal pipes?
@THEfromkentucky
@THEfromkentucky 7 лет назад
Corrosion is a matter of chemistry. Not all salts corrode all metals. One example is Hastelloy-N, an alloy specifically formulated for the Beryllium-Fluoride salt used in the Molten Salt Reactor Experiment at Oak Ridge National Laboratory in the 1960s. It operated for 5 years with no significant corrosion.
